Ancona Italy

Ancona is a port city located in the Marche region of central Italy. It is known for its rich history and cultural heritage, as well as its stunning natural beauty. One of the main attractions in Ancona is the Cathedral of San Ciriaco, which is a beautiful Romanesque church that dates back to the 11th century. The church is known for its impressive mosaics, as well as its beautiful frescoes and sculptures.

Another popular attraction in Ancona is the Arch of Trajan, which is a Roman triumphal arch that was built in the 2nd century AD. The arch is an important piece of ancient Roman architecture and is a popular spot for tourists to visit.

Ancona is also home to several museums and galleries, including the Museo Archeologico Nazionale delle Marche, which is dedicated to the history and culture of the Marche region. The museum houses a collection of artifacts and artworks from the region's past, including ancient Roman and Etruscan artifacts.

For those who are interested in nature and outdoor activities, Ancona is a great destination. The city is surrounded by beautiful countryside and there are many hiking and biking trails nearby. The Conero Regional Park is a great place to visit for those who want to explore the local flora and fauna. The park is home to a wide variety of bird species, as well as several species of butterflies and wildflowers.
